Background
Catecholamine-induced Takotsubo Syndrome (cat-TS) is a type of secondary Takotsubo syndrome, characterized by rapid onset of symptoms, high rate of complications during the acute phase, good short-term prognosis, and frequent apical sparing at echocardiogram.
